Why Choose PDFs for Business Plans?

PDFs have become the standard for document sharing across industries. Their popularity stems from several key advantages:

  • Consistency: PDFs maintain formatting across different devices and platforms. This means your carefully crafted layouts and designs will look the same, whether viewed on a laptop, tablet, or smartphone.
  • Security: You can password-protect PDFs and restrict editing capabilities, ensuring that sensitive information remains confidential.
  • Accessibility: PDFs can be read on almost any device without the need for specific software, making them universally accessible.

These features make PDFs an ideal choice when you want to present a polished, professional business plan.

Utilizing Annotations and Comments

PDFs allow for annotations, which can be incredibly useful for refining your business plan. Team members can highlight sections, add comments, or propose changes directly on the document. This feature streamlines communication and minimizes misunderstandings.

Moreover, when revisions are made, the original content remains intact, allowing you to track your business plan’s evolution. This is particularly beneficial when you wish to reflect on the decision-making process or present the rationale behind certain strategies to investors or stakeholders.
